Kanazawa University research: Unraveling DNA packaging

Researchers at Kanazawa University report in the Journal of Physical Chemistry Letters how high-speed atomic force microscopy can be used for studying DNA wrapping processes.  The technique enables visualizing the dynamics of DNA–protein interactions, which in certain cases resembles the motion of inchworms.
